Recently on FUBAR Radio, Cheryl Fergison has opened up about the shocking revelation that her mum kept her pregnancy with the EastEnders actress completely under wraps.
Chatting to host Andrew White on the radio programme Pulse Of The Nation, the soap star opened up about her mother keeping her pregnancy a secret: “There's been some real ups and downs in my life. It started in an odd way, and we joking in the family that, I started off as appendicitis because my mum hid me. I mean she hid her pregnancy, so everybody thought she was going in for an appendicitis, and it wasn't out popped me.”

Also in this episode, Fergison spoke about her financial difficulties and how her co-star helped: “I got cancer and I couldn't afford my mortgage, people like Barbara Windsor and Linda Henry, they all helped out. I went to Barbara's house and I was only about a week away from having surgery, and she literally wrote a cheque out for my mortgage and for bills for me for the next couple of months”
